+Utility to find which libraries could define a given symbol
+"""
+from argparse import ArgumentParser
+from os.path import join, splitext
+from os import walk
+from subprocess import Popen, PIPE
+
+
+OBJ_EXT = ['.o', '.a', '.ar']
+
+
+def find_sym_in_lib(sym, obj_path):
+ contain_symbol = False
+
+ out = Popen(["nm", "-C", obj_path], stdout=PIPE, stderr=PIPE).communicate()[0]
+ for line in out.splitlines():
+ tokens = line.split()
+ n = len(tokens)
+ if n == 2:
+ sym_type = tokens[0]
+ sym_name = tokens[1]
+ elif n == 3:
+ sym_type = tokens[1]
+ sym_name = tokens[2]
+ else:
+ continue
+
+ if sym_type == "U":
+ # This object is using this symbol, not defining it
+ continue
+
+ if sym_name == sym:
+ contain_symbol = True
+
+ return contain_symbol
+
+
+def find_sym_in_path(sym, dir_path):
+ for root, _, files in walk(dir_path):
+ for file in files:
+
+ _, ext = splitext(file)
+ if ext not in OBJ_EXT: continue
+
+ path = join(root, file)
+ if find_sym_in_lib(sym, path):
+ print path
+
+
+if __name__ == '__main__':
+ parser = ArgumentParser(description='Find Symbol')
+ parser.add_argument('-s', '--sym', required=True,
+ help='The symbol to be searched')
+ parser.add_argument('-p', '--path', required=True,
+ help='The path where to search')
+ args = parser.parse_args()
+
+ find_sym_in_path(args.sym, args.path)
